QuickStart – Get Up & Running Fast

A. Handheld Microphone and two Duet Speakers

  1. Charge Components GoSpeak! Duet’s Speakers, Handheld Wireless Microphone, and Lavalier Transmitter can be operated either on battery power or while charging. Generally, however, confirm that they are fully charged before use. See ‘Charging GoSpeak! Duet:
  2. Power Up Speaker(s) Positioning Duet speakers around the room for maximum coverage, press (and hold for 5 seconds) the speaker’s Power/ On/Off button. An audible prompt will confirm, ‘Power On: Repeat the step with the second speaker.
  3. Use the Handheld Microphone To activate your Handheld Wireless Microphone, press the microphone’s On/Off/Pairing button three times in rapid succession. Your microphone should now be operational. If feedback occurs, reduce the volume level of the speakers: repositioning them to be more in front of you in the room.

Playing Audio Content

In addition to its handheld and lavalier wireless microphones, GoSpeak! Duet is configured to amplify external audio from a variety of sources including cable-connected audio electronics and Bluetooth” wireless devices.

  1. Direct Connection Powering on a Duet speaker, connect to external audio sources using the 1/S” stereo cable (supplied), routing one end to the aux” speaker input (right side), and the other to your audio source. Activate direct connection audio by pressing and holding the M key on the top of the speaker.
  2. Bluetootlf’ Powering on a Duet speaker, enable Bluetooth on your external audio device. Follow the device prompts from your device, selecting ‘GoSpeak!’ to wirelessly pair the speaker. Adjust the volume using the speaker volume controls, those on your external device, or both.

Charging GoSpeak! Duet

Your GoSpeak! Duet is environmentally friendly, with all components using ‘green’ rechargeable batteries. While providing for easy setup and use, it also means that GoSpeak! Duet components must be charged from time to time.

  • Charging Duet Speakers Charging your Duet speakers is easy. Insert the AC Adapter cable (supplied) into the speaker’s charging port (right side), and plug the Adapter into an AC outlet. The Battery Charge indicator will show four solid bars when charging is complete (3~5 hours).
  • Charging the Handheld Microphone When its On/Off/Power button starts to flash red, it’s time to charge your Handheld Wireless Microphone. Insert the Micro USB end of the charging cable (supplied) into the microphone’s charging port, and the other to an AC/USB Plug (supplied). Plug the AC/USB Plug into a wall outlet to begin charging. When complete, the mic’s On/Off Power button glows solid (3~5 hours).
  • Charging the Lavalier Transmitter When the LavalierTransmitter’s Battery Indicator begins to glow yellow, its battery is at 50% power. When the button starts to glow red, the transmitter will need to be charged again soon. Insert the Micro USB end of the charging cable into the transmitter charging port, and the other to an AC/USB Plug. Plug the AC/USB Plug into a wall outlet to begin charging. Charging is complete when the transmitter’s Battery Indicator glows solid blue (3~5 hours).

Troubleshooting – Pairing Components

Both the Handheld Wireless Microphone and the LavalierTransmitter are pre- paired at the factory with your GoSpeak! Duet speakers. Should your GoSpeak! need to be paired again, pair all items in the system by following these simple steps:

  1. Press (holding for 5 seconds) the Power/On/Off on both speakers to turn them on.
  2. Press (holding for 5 seconds) the UHF Button on both speakers, putting them in pairing mode. The status LED on each speaker will blink when ready.
  3. With both speakers in UHF paring mode, press (holding for 5 seconds) the wireless microphone’s On/Off/Pairing button, turning the microphone on.
  4. Now, tap the microphone’s On/Off/Pairing button 3 times in succession to pair it with your speakers. The status LEDs on each speaker will turn solid when the pairing is complete. Leave the microphone on after pairing.
  5. Finally, repeat Step 2 above to put your speakers back in UHF pairing mode. Plug the Lavalier microphone into its wireless transmitter. Power up the transmitter using its rotary switch. Press and briefly hold the Pair button on the transmitter to connect it to your speakers.
  6. Confirm that your Wireless Microphone and your Lavalier Microphone are now being heard through both speakers.
